BREAKING: Slow Moving Fire Near Hansen Dam

Los Angeles City Firefighters responded to a fire in the Hansen Dam area. The call came in at 12:54 A.M. concerning a brush fire at 11798 W Foothill Blvd. Firefighters are unable to access a very remote area of the Hansen Dam Recreation Area which has a slow moving vegetation fire. Saddleridge Brush Fire Update:

Saddleridge Brush Fire Update from Los Angeles City Fire as of 4:22 a.m.: The fire has burned over 4,000 acres, a more accurate assessment will be made after sunrise. The fire is 0% contained. BREAKING: 6.4 Quake in Ridgecrest

BREAKING: 6.4 Quake in Ridgecrest

A M6.4 earthquake occurred 12 km Southwest of Searles Valley, CA, just outside of Ridgecrest, CA in the Mojave Desert. Shaking was reported as far away as Mexico. More details on this will be reported as they become available.
